How Much Does an Associate in English Language & Literature from Nashua Community College Cost?

$7,140 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Nashua Community College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Nashua Community College paid an average of $490 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$215 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$6,450$14,700
Fees$690$690
Books and Supplies$1,400$1,400

Does Nashua Community College Offer an Online AA in English Language & Literature?

Online degrees for the Nashua Community College English language and literature associate degree program are not available at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the Nashua Community College Online Learning page.

Nashua Community College Associate Student Diversity for English Language & Literature

2 Associate Degrees Awarded
50.0% Women
50.0%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 2 associate degrees in English language and literature hand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 50.0% of the English language and literature students who took home an associate degree in 2019-2020. This is less than the nationwide number of 67.1%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 50.0% of English language and literature associate degree recipients at Nashua Community College in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 59%.
